What is Subtitle player
Subtitle player is a plugin for Enigma2 based satellite receivers (Vu+, Ipbox, Dreambox, Kathrein, Topfield...) featuring:
Imdb plugin
- you can use plugin to get all kind of information's about the movie, on original language or translated with Google Translate. Also, it translates movie titles from various languages if possible (for example if you search EPG of German, Polish, Dutch provider you will get original movie title and info about the movie on English). Advantage of this plugin comparing to original IMDB plugin is
- speed (it's a lot faster because it has direct access to the epg of current channel)
- has an option to manually specify search terms
- enables translation of results to other languages
Subtitle downloader
- downloads subtitles from internet and translates movies and series titles over epg or manual.
Subtitles are downloaded from next databases
- Podnapisi.net
- Titlovi.com
- Opensubtitles.org
- Perfectsat dtc base(only dtc)
Subtitle player
featuring subtitle display in the movies or series without conversion. Something like Drtic but with more options. Movies can be subtitled regardless if you're watching them live or as a recording.

PLUGIN SETUP
Run plugin and then start adjust the basic settings

Push the yellow button (settings)

Setup as you like - this is mine configuration
Download subtitle server------> Setup server for download (use LEFT/RIGHT buttons)
Set Subtitle Languages -----------------> Adjust yours language(s)
Choose font -----------------------> use LEFT/RIGHT buttons to choose which type of font you want to use for the subtitles (you can add your font in font folder)
Enter the font size -----------> Set size of subtitle font
Font Color --------------------------> Here adjusts color of subtitle
Background ---------------------------> Here set type of tape on the background behind the subtitles
Save settings --------------------> Here adjust do you want to save on exit
Next step is to setup a subtitle folder - in my case usb/media/Titlovi (you can use HDD, USB, CF or leave default as it is).
Use Blue button for setup, go up with <Parent directory> and then go to your folder and it will stay as default

Still remaines to adjust the subtitle position on screen
Yellow button ---> Change Subtitle Position

And then move with up and down buttons as you like
